gpt4 book ai didi

ios - 使用标识符执行 segue 不会在 swift 2 中工作

转载 作者:可可西里 更新时间:2023-11-01 03:22:23 25 4
gpt4 key购买 nike

我一直在使用这段代码在用户登录到应用程序时执行自定义转场:

dispatch_async(dispatch_get_main_queue()){

self.performSegueWithIdentifier("showSTPS", sender: self)

}

我目前在我的 perpareForSegue 中有这段代码(我不确定我是否需要它)

override func prepareForSegue(segue: UIStoryboardSegue, sender: AnyObject?){
if "showSTPS" == segue.identifier {
}
}

每次我尝试执行 segue 时都会收到以下错误:

2015-08-31 11:56:28.998 ICEFLO[3858:651041] *** Terminating app due to uncaught exception 'NSInternalInconsistencyException', reason: 'Could not perform segue with identifier 'showSTPS'. A segue must either have a performHandler or it must override -perform.'

如有任何建议,我们将不胜感激 - 请注意,这是针对 swift2/ios9 的

-瑜珈

最佳答案

确保在您的 Storyboard 中,segue 类型未设置为自定义。如果将其设置为自定义,则需要提供自己的自定义 segue 类。

关于ios - 使用标识符执行 segue 不会在 swift 2 中工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32309909/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com